How High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Works

When you call our team for high-velocity air mover drying, we’ll dispatch a crew to your property within 60 minutes. They’ll ass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your space dry and safe. Our technicians use specialized equipment, including high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ers, to circulate air and evaporate moisture quickly and efficiently.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will evaluate the extent of the damage and identify the best course of action. They’ll use specialized sensors to measure moisture levels and find out the most effective drying strategy. This step typically takes 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 2: Equipment Setup

Our team will set up high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to begin the drying process. These machines will work tirelessly to circulate air and evaporate moisture, speeding up the drying time. You can expect to see significant progress within the first 24 hours.

Step 3: Monitoring and Adjustment

Our technicians will regularly monitor the drying process and adjust the equipment as needed. They’ll check moisture levels, temperature, and humidity to ensure the environment is conducive to drying. This step typically takes 2-3 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Once the drying process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and dry. They’ll remove any equipment and clean up the area, leaving your space looking like new. This step typically takes a few hours to a day, depending on the size of the affected area.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a hard surface Yes No Easy to clean and dry with minimal equipment.
Water damage in a large room or multiple rooms No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ry effectively and prevent mold growth.
Mold growth on walls or ceilings No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ent further growth.
Visible structural damage or warping No Yes Needs immediate attention from a professional to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age in a crawl space or attic No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ely access and dry these areas.
High humidity or temperature fluctuations No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to identify and address the underlying issue.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Cost in Hahnville, LA

The cost of high-velocity air mover drying can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hahnville, LA.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$200 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of the job
Equipment Rental and Setup $500 – $2,000 Number of air movers and dehumidifiers needed, duration of the drying process
Monitoring and Adjustment $100 – $500 Frequency of monitoring, complexity of the job, and number of adjustments needed
Final Inspection and Cleanup $200 – $500 Size of the affected area, complexity of the job, and number of hours required for cleanup
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, structural repairs) $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of the damage, complexity of the job, and number of services required

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a more accurate estimate after conducting an on-site assessment.
